• Hi guys my site was fine for ages but suddenly has been getting a very frustrating error. Every so often the site goes down and gives the following error:

    This site can’t be reached www.nitryl.co.uk unexpectedly closed the connection.
    
    ERR_CONNECTION_CLOSED

    Looking at my hosting the resource manager in cpanel is saying the following:

    CPU resources limit was reached for your site
    I/O usage resources limit was reached for your site

    What would have caused the error happening suddenly? It appears to happen most of the time when trying to work within the wp admin.Because of this it’s quite hard to try and fix things and to add a caching plugin because it just keeps crashing mid processes.

    The site’s plugins are set to auto update so I’m assuming this could be the issue. Could it also be fixed by increasing some stats in the config files? Any help with how to fix this would be greatly appreciated.

    GoDaddy should know better than that. ” Every so often the site goes down” usually means there’s a resource issue on the server. If WP were broken, it would be broken all the time.

    In addition, check your traffic as well if there is an attack or bot crawler using your site resources.
